The IELTS Exam (International English Language Testing System) is one of the world’s most popular English proficiency tests, accepted by over 11,000 organizations globally. It is designed to assess how effectively you can communicate in English across four core skills: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king.

Whether you’re planning to study at a university abroad, apply for a job in an English-speaking country, or migrate permanently, the IELTS Exam is often a mandatory requirement in the process.

There are two main types of IELTS:

  • IELTS Academic – for those applying to universities or higher education programs

  • IELTS General Training – for work, training programs, or immigration purposes

Both versions are trusted by governments, employers, and institutions worldwide. Taking the IELTS Exam shows your readiness to live, work, or study in an English-speaking environment and is a vital first step toward your global journey.

The Four Pillars of IELTS: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king

The IELTS Exam is divided into four sections, each designed to assess a specific skill:

1. 🎧 Listening

You’ll hear recordings of native English conversations, lectures, and instructions. You’ll need to answer questions to show how well you understood the context and details.

2. 📖 Reading

Three long texts — could be academic articles or general interest materials — and 40 questions that test your comprehension, scanning, and interpretation skills.

3. ✍️ Writing

This section includes two tasks. In the Academic version, Task 1 involves analyzing a graph or chart, while Task 2 is a formal essay. General version includes letter writing and essay.

4. 🗣️ Speaking

This is a face-to-face interview (or now via video call in many centers). You’ll speak on general topics, express opinions, and answer cue card-based questions — exactly like in the real IELTS Exam.

Why is the IELTS Exam Important?

It’s globally accepted
More than 11,000 institutions in over 140 countries trust IELTS scores.

It unlocks education & career opportunities
A high IELTS score can improve your chances of getting admitted to top universities or landing international jobs.

It supports migration
Countries like Canada, Australia, the UK, and New Zealand use IELTS scores for visa and immigration eligibility.

How to Prepare for IELTS Speaking Cue Cards Effectively

Memorising answers to cue cards rarely works in the IELTS speaking test. Examiners are trained to spot rehearsed responses. Instead, focus on building a framework you can apply to any topic:

  • The 4-sentence framework: Open with what/who/where, explain why it matters to you, give a specific detail or story, and close with how it connects to your life today. This works for virtually any Part 2 topic.
  • Practise with a timer: You get 1 minute to prepare and 2 minutes to speak. Practise hitting the 2-minute mark without running out of things to say — or stopping too early.
  • Record yourself: Listen for filler words (um, uh, like), long pauses, and grammar errors you repeat consistently. These patterns are easier to fix when you hear them.

Common Mistakes That Lower Your IELTS Speaking Score

Avoid these mistakes that consistently cost candidates 0.5 to 1.0 band points:

  • Using overly complex vocabulary incorrectly: Simple, accurate English scores higher than complicated English used wrongly. The examiner is testing your ability to communicate clearly, not your dictionary knowledge.
  • Not extending your answers: In Parts 1 and 3, one-word answers signal low fluency. Always give a reason, example, or comparison alongside your answer.
  • Ignoring pronunciation: Word stress, sentence intonation, and clear vowel sounds matter more than accent. Daily practice with a human partner (not just an AI app) helps you catch pronunciation habits you cannot hear yourself.
  • Speaking too fast: Speed does not equal fluency. Speaking at a natural, clear pace with good sentence structure scores higher than rapid speech full of errors.

FAQs: Your IELTS Speaking Questions Answered

Does an accent matter when taking the speaking portion of the IELTS exam?

In the IELTS speaking exam, accent matters less than clarity, fluency, and proper pronunciation. Focus on being understood rather than altering your natural accent.

Is it okay to ask the examiner to repeat the question?

Yes, you can ask the examiner to repeat or clarify the question. It’s better to understand the question correctly than to answer inaccurately.

How can I manage my nervousness during the IELTS Speaking test?

Can using complex vocabulary improve my IELTS Speaking score?

Yes, but clarity is key. Use complex vocabulary correctly and ensure it enhances the clarity and relevance of your response.

How important is pronunciation in the IELTS Speaking test?

Pronunciation is crucial. It can significantly affect your clarity and comprehension. Focus on practicing difficult sounds and intonation patterns.

What strategies can I use to prepare for cue card topics?

Familiarize yourself with common topics, practice speaking for two minutes on each topic, and structure your answers with a clear beginning, middle, and end.
